Essential Skills for an M.Sc. in Biophysics

Pursuing an M.Sc. in Biophysics requires a blend of scientific aptitude, technical skills, and analytical thinking. A strong foundation in physics, mathematics, chemistry, and biology is essential. Key skills include:

  • Analytical Skills: Ability to analyze complex biological systems using physical and mathematical principles.
  • Problem-Solving Skills: Capacity to identify and solve research problems related to biological processes.
  • Technical Proficiency: Expertise in biophysical techniques such as spectroscopy, microscopy, X-ray crystallography, and computational modeling.
  • Programming Skills: Familiarity with programming languages like Python or R for data analysis and simulations.
  • Communication Skills: Ability to effectively communicate research findings through presentations and publications.
  • Mathematical Skills: A solid understanding of calculus, differential equations, and statistics is crucial.
  • Critical Thinking: Evaluating scientific literature and experimental data objectively.
  • Interdisciplinary Knowledge: Integrating concepts from physics, biology, and chemistry.

How to Develop These Skills:

  • Coursework: Focus on core biophysics courses and related subjects.
  • Laboratory Experience: Gain hands-on experience with biophysical techniques.
  • Research Projects: Participate in research projects to apply theoretical knowledge.
  • Workshops and Seminars: Attend workshops and seminars to learn about the latest advancements in the field.
  • Online Resources: Utilize online resources and tutorials to enhance programming and data analysis skills.

Developing these skills will significantly enhance your prospects in the field of biophysics and open doors to diverse career opportunities.

Essential Skills for M.Sc. Biophysics Success

To excel in an M.Sc. Biophysics program and subsequent career, a blend of scientific acumen and technical skills is crucial. Here's a breakdown of the key skills you'll need:

  • Strong Foundation in Physics, Chemistry, and Biology: A solid understanding of these core sciences is fundamental. You should be comfortable with concepts like thermodynamics, kinetics, molecular biology, and quantum mechanics.
  • Mathematical Proficiency: Biophysics relies heavily on mathematical modeling. Skills in calculus, differential equations, linear algebra, and statistics are essential for data analysis and interpretation.
  • Programming Skills: Proficiency in programming languages like Python, R, or MATLAB is increasingly important for data analysis, simulations, and computational modeling in biophysics.
  • Analytical and Problem-Solving Skills: Biophysicists are often tasked with solving complex problems at the interface of physics and biology. Strong analytical and critical thinking skills are necessary to design experiments, interpret data, and draw meaningful conclusions.
  • Data Analysis and Interpretation: The ability to analyze large datasets, identify trends, and interpret results is crucial. This includes familiarity with statistical methods and data visualization techniques.
  • Communication Skills: Biophysicists need to effectively communicate their research findings to both scientific and non-scientific audiences. Strong written and oral communication skills are essential for presentations, publications, and collaborations.
  • Computational Skills: Knowledge of bioinformatics tools and databases is beneficial for analyzing biological data and understanding complex biological systems.
  • Experimental Techniques: Hands-on experience with various biophysical techniques, such as spectroscopy, microscopy, and electrophoresis, is highly valuable.

Developing these skills will not only help you succeed in your M.Sc. Biophysics program but also prepare you for a rewarding career in research, academia, or industry.

M.Sc. Biophysics: Exploring Top Specialization Areas

An M.Sc. in Biophysics offers diverse specialization options, allowing you to focus on specific areas of interest. Here are some of the top specializations:

  • Molecular Biophysics: Focuses on the structure, dynamics, and function of biological molecules like proteins, DNA, and RNA. This specialization often involves techniques like X-ray crystallography, NMR spectroscopy, and molecular dynamics simulations.
  • Cellular Biophysics: Explores the physical properties and processes within cells, including membrane transport, cell signaling, and cell mechanics. Techniques used include microscopy, electrophysiology, and single-molecule techniques.
  • Membrane Biophysics: Studies the structure, function, and dynamics of biological membranes. This specialization involves techniques like lipidomics, membrane protein reconstitution, and simulations of membrane behavior.
  • Neurobiophysics: Investigates the physical principles underlying neural function, including ion channel biophysics, synaptic transmission, and neural network dynamics. Techniques used include electrophysiology, optical imaging, and computational modeling.
  • Computational Biophysics: Uses computational methods to model and simulate biological systems. This specialization involves developing and applying algorithms for molecular dynamics simulations, protein structure prediction, and drug design.
  • Structural Biophysics: Determines the three-dimensional structures of biological molecules using techniques like X-ray crystallography, cryo-electron microscopy, and NMR spectroscopy. This information is crucial for understanding protein function and drug design.
  • Biomaterials and Tissue Engineering: Applies biophysical principles to design and develop new biomaterials and tissue engineering strategies. This specialization involves understanding the interactions between cells and materials, and developing scaffolds for tissue regeneration.
  • Medical Biophysics: Applies biophysical techniques to diagnose and treat diseases. This specialization includes areas like medical imaging, radiation therapy, and drug delivery.

Choosing a specialization depends on your interests and career goals. Researching different areas and talking to faculty members can help you make an informed decision.
